Understanding Sonos and HEOS

Before we dive into the compatibility question, it’s essential to understand what Sonos and HEOS are and how they work.

Sonos

Sonos is a well-known brand in the home audio industry, famous for its wireless speakers that can be easily controlled using a smartphone app. Sonos speakers are known for their high-quality sound, sleek design, and ease of use. The brand offers a range of speakers, including the popular Sonos One, Sonos Beam, and Sonos Playbar. Sonos speakers use a proprietary wireless technology that allows them to connect to each other and to the internet, enabling users to stream music from various services like Spotify, Apple Music, and Amazon Music.

HEOS

HEOS is a wireless audio system developed by Denon, a renowned brand in the audio industry. HEOS is designed to provide a whole-home audio experience, allowing users to control and play music in different rooms using a single app. HEOS speakers are known for their high-quality sound, compact design, and affordability. The brand offers a range of speakers, including the HEOS 1, HEOS 3, and HEOS 5. HEOS speakers use a proprietary wireless technology that allows them to connect to each other and to the internet, enabling users to stream music from various services like Spotify, Apple Music, and Amazon Music.

Can Sonos Speakers Work with HEOS?

Now that we’ve understood what Sonos and HEOS are, let’s get to the million-dollar question: can Sonos speakers work with HEOS? The short answer is no, Sonos speakers cannot work seamlessly with HEOS speakers. Here’s why:

  • Proprietary Technology: Both Sonos and HEOS use proprietary wireless technologies that are not compatible with each other. Sonos speakers use the SonosNet technology, while HEOS speakers use the HEOS technology. These technologies are designed to work only with their respective brands, making it difficult for them to interact with each other.
  • Different Operating Systems: Sonos and HEOS have different operating systems that control their speakers. Sonos speakers run on the Sonos operating system, while HEOS speakers run on the HEOS operating system. These operating systems are not compatible, making it challenging to integrate Sonos speakers with HEOS speakers.
  • No Official Support: Neither Sonos nor HEOS officially supports the integration of their speakers with each other. This means that you won’t find any official documentation or software updates that enable Sonos speakers to work with HEOS speakers.

Can I use Sonos speakers with a HEOS system?

Unfortunately, Sonos speakers are not compatible with the HEOS system, and vice versa. Sonos has its own proprietary wireless technology that only works with other Sonos devices, while HEOS uses a different wireless protocol that’s exclusive to Denon and Marantz products. This means you can’t mix and match Sonos and HEOS speakers in the same system, at least not without using some kind of workaround or third-party bridge.

That being said, there are some third-party solutions that allow you to integrate Sonos and HEOS systems, but these often require additional hardware and can be complicated to set up. It’s generally recommended to stick with one ecosystem or the other, rather than trying to mix and match devices from different manufacturers.

What are the advantages of Sonos over HEOS?

Sonos has several advantages over HEOS, including a wider range of products, more features, and a more seamless user experience. Sonos speakers are generally considered more premium and better-sounding, with more advanced audio processing and higher-quality drivers. Sonos also has a more extensive range of compatible services and devices, including Amazon Alexa and Google Assistant integration.

Another key advantage of Sonos is its Trueplay tuning technology, which allows the speakers to automatically adjust their sound quality based on the room they’re in. Sonos also has a more comprehensive app and more advanced multi-room audio features, making it easier to control and customize your music experience.

What are the advantages of HEOS over Sonos?

HEOS has several advantages over Sonos, including a lower price point and a simpler setup process. HEOS speakers are generally more affordable than their Sonos counterparts, making them a more accessible option for budget-conscious consumers. HEOS also has a more streamlined setup process, with fewer steps and less complexity than Sonos.

Another key advantage of HEOS is its open architecture, which allows for more third-party integrations and customizations. HEOS is also more compatible with other Denon and Marantz devices, making it a great option for users who are already invested in these ecosystems. However, it’s worth noting that HEOS has fewer features and a more limited range of products than Sonos.

Can I control my HEOS system with my voice?

Yes, HEOS systems are compatible with Amazon Alexa and Google Assistant, which means you can control your music experience using voice commands. This allows you to play, pause, and skip tracks, as well as adjust the volume and change the music source, all using just your voice.

However, it’s worth noting that HEOS voice control is not as seamless as Sonos, which has more advanced voice control capabilities and integrations. Sonos also has more microphones and better far-field voice recognition, making it easier to control your music experience from across the room.
